I don't know if they know him, but man Bodiroga was a monster. Even craftier than Goran, off the charts fundamentals and bball IQ. 6'9 PG if you needed him to be. He was indeed slow, and not a great shooter but you could always count on him to make the big play or shot. He absolutely dominated in Europe. I had the pleasure of watching him play for Real Madrid and Barcelona. Especially with Barca, he was the real leader of that euroleague title team, much more than Navarro and Sarunas.
And yes, there is a little of that in Saric, although I wouldn't dare to say that he will reach that level.
